Importance of women empowerment

According to UN, economic empowerment of women includes women’s ability to participate equally in existing market. They have access to and control over productives resources, access to decent work, control over their own time, reduces the gap of inequality, and meaningful participation in economic decision-making at all level. When women are empowered and work it reduces poverty, boost productivity in all economic sector, ensure food security and even improve on the health of women.Unfortunately in Africa we still have a high rate of illiterate women/girls because of poverty, early marriage and early pregnancy, factors hindering their education . According to Quora women constitutes about 50% of the world population, a large number of them are unemployed, unskilled, and illiterate.
